The Securities and Exchange Board of India, or SEBI Grade A exam pattern, underwent changes in 2018:

  • The Securities Market subject was removed from Phase 1 and Phase 2.
  • Paper 2 was introduced in Phase 1 containing multiple choice questions on Commerce, Accountancy, Management, Finance, Costing, Companies Act and Economics.
  • Paper 2 was introduced in Phase 2 containing multiple choice questions on Commerce, Accountancy, Management, Finance, Costing, Companies Act and Economics.

Therefore, focusing on SEBI Grade A PYQs after 2018 instead of the past 10 years of papers will ensure your preparation aligns with the current exam format.

SEBI Grade A Descriptive English Past Year Paper Analysis

Generally, 3 questions are asked, one each from essay, precis, and reading comprehension

Essay topics asked in the SEBI Grade A 2022 exam:

  • Mental health and its impact
  • Role of banks in providing financial literacy
  • Techno stress – its impact on students and teachers working in education
  • About ARCs and their functions

Essay topics asked in the SEBI Grade A 2020 exam:

  • Importance of teamwork
  • Fake news and how to identify them
  • Pros and cons of mergers and acquisitions of companies
  • How to prevent financial crime with help of technology

SEBI Grade A Descriptive English Difficulty Level

The overall difficulty level of essay, precis, and reading comprehension asked in the SEBI Grade A is easy to moderate.

How to Use SEBI Grade A PYQs for Your Preparation?

  • If you’re serious about SEBI Grade A, treat previous year question papers as a core study tool, not a one-time glance.
  • Regular practice helps you understand trends, refine accuracy, and focus on high-weight topics.

Here’s how to use these SEBI Grade A PYQs the smart way, not just to see what came, but to actually guide your entire prep:

1. Start by solving full papers

Attempt one full SEBI Grade A previous year paper set in exam-like conditions. Don’t just read through. Solve it with a timer and track your performance honestly.

2. Analyse what went wrong

Check which questions you got wrong and why. Was it a concept issue, a silly mistake, or time pressure? This is where the real improvement starts.

3. Spot the important topics

Go through 2–3 years of papers and see which topics show up again and again. Focus your prep around them. They matter more than the rest.

4. Use them as mocks

Once you’ve studied a subject, try a past paper section as a mini mock. This helps you test concepts in exam format and improves recall under pressure.

5. Build your question log

Keep a simple log of PYQ questions you found tricky or got wrong. Revise these regularly.  This is better than going back to full notes every time.

6. Track your progress

Come back to the same PYQ set after 2–3 weeks. See what’s changed. If you’re getting more answers right now, you know your prep is working.

7. Boost your confidence

The more familiar you get with actual SEBI papers, the less fear you’ll feel before the real exam. PYQs help reduce uncertainty and give you control.
